Transaction 11532a663b308f5890594c056b1f55d79a44af3adb2d6bd151d07afa49783651
1 Input
1 Output
-
11532a663b308f5890594c056b1f55d79a44af3adb2d6bd151d07afa49783651:0
- value
- 899195
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f4780b3ec87a94f3e2d7980e6e3073cd4959427 OP_EQUAL
- address
- 3Lb1TMHLFX6sWQLDiW5CZDuHkXG1kJWHRX